zoukankan      html  css  js  c++  java
  • Jmeter中的变量(三)

    变量(Variables)

    Jmeter中的变量(参数化)目的是为了提供改变请求变化的机制。比如登录场景,一般不能使用同一个账号做并发操作。

    变量的特点

     1) JMeter变量对于测试线程而言是局部变量。这就意味着JMeter变量在不同测试线程中,既可 以是完全相同的,也可以是不同的。     

     2)如果有某个线程更新了变量,那么仅仅是更新了变量在该线程中复制的值。例如,"正则表达 式提取器"(后置处理器)会依据它所在线程的采样结果来更新变量值,该变量值可以供相同的线 程后续使用

    如何生成变量?

    1、使用后置处理器,自动生成变量

    2、事先定义变量:在测试计划中 进行用户自定义变量  添加,然后再请求中引用测试计划中定义的变量即可。引用方法${变量名}

    Debug Sampler :【线程组】右键—>Sampler—>Debug Sampler ,该采样器 可以获取属性信息

     用户自定变量的添加

    用户自定义组件  无论放置在任何位置,都可以被所有线程所使用。没有任何的层级关系,不受作用域控制

    【线程组】—>【添加】—>【用户自定义变量】

  • 相关阅读:
    eclipse中jdk源码调试步骤
    [POJ2777] Count Color
    [HNOI2004] L语言
    [USACO08DEC] 秘密消息Secret Message
    The XOR Largest Pair [Trie]
    前缀统计 [Trie]
    于是他错误的点名开始了 [Trie]
    Palindrome [Manecher]
    兔子与兔子 [Hash]
    [CF985F] Isomorphic Strings
  • 原文地址:https://www.cnblogs.com/linxinmeng/p/9305200.html
Copyright © 2011-2022 走看看